I've been trying to organize my insane number of TTRPG books, materials, maps and tables and it's been a struggle to find a system that works for me.

Instead of trying to organize everything, I've split my goal into parts and will approach it one step at a time:

  • Prepping games
  • Generating encounters
  • Learning rules / new systems

Currently, I'm making a template for how I want to prep my games.

That will determine how I generate encounters, and I'll start listing the books/materials that can help me.

And for rules/systems I am learning Pirate Borg now. One "rule" I want to work on (and I am guilty of shutting down players) is to stop saying "no," but instead "yes... but" and giving them bigger consequences for their decisions.

As I DM longer and longer, I struggle with staying organized and preventing myself from "over prepping." This also makes me feel burned out at times as I have trouble finding what I need, and then over-planning sessions creating additional issues (such as prepping things that aren't even used and feeling overwhelmed).

It's all a process and a learning opportunity. I'm excited to see what I can learn next!
